WHAT IS CREATIVITY........ STILL SEARCHING......
Creativity is the ability to use imagination, insight and intellect - as well as feeling and emotion - to move an idea from its present state to an alternate, previously unexplored state. Angelique Burzynski
Creativity is an end to any means that is constructed to be shared and
created to inspire and to motivate. Salvador Palacios
Creativity is the expression of inner emotions. Liliana
Perez
Creatvity is one's own imagination coming out in the real world.
Nilou Yamini
Creativity is the process of taking something (or an idea) and making it
your own creation. Erin Goulding
Creativity is the ability to have "unique" thoughts and feelings about
anything and everything. Toni Bowes
Creativity is a subjective term which entails using your brain and making
yourself and others happy. Sara Deardorff
Creativity is your personal touch - born of individualism. Jackie Lynn
Tosches
Creativity is the art of organizing thoughts in different ways - other
than "standard" ways of doing things. It is a reflection of feelings,
ideas and perspectives. Nancy Perez
Creativity is the ability to combine physical things and imaginary things
to make something new - sometimes unusual. Geronimo Mendoza
Creativity is an expression that one can use to refer to many different
things: dancing, writing, etc. Creativity can be thought of as something
unique. Karen Spencer
Creativity is the ability to have an open mind to limitless
possibilities through exploration and experiences. Ruben
Salvador
Creativity is something unique to an individual - a talent or gift.
Frances Bandi Truitt
Creativity is the ability to use and share the God-given talents we were
endowed with. I believe that these talents are what makes a person and
defines his/her personality. It is through these talents that a person
can express himself/herself. Minerva Rozo
